SIC Code 5947-13 Description (6-Digit)

Gift Baskets & Parcels (Retail) is an industry that specializes in creating and selling gift baskets and parcels for various occasions. These baskets and parcels are typically filled with a range of items such as food, beverages, and small gifts. The industry involves creating customized baskets and parcels for customers based on their preferences and needs. Gift Baskets & Parcels (Retail) is a popular industry for those looking to give a thoughtful and personalized gift.

Value Chain Analysis for SIC 5947-13

Value Chain Position

Category: Retailer
Value Stage: Final
Description: The Gift Baskets & Parcels (Retail) industry operates as a retailer within the final value stage, focusing on the sale of customized gift baskets and parcels directly to consumers. This industry is characterized by its ability to create personalized products that cater to various occasions, enhancing the gifting experience for customers.

Upstream Industries

  • Miscellaneous Food Stores - SIC 5499
    Importance: Critical
    Description: This industry supplies a variety of gourmet food items, snacks, and beverages that are essential for creating appealing gift baskets. The inputs received are vital for ensuring that the baskets are filled with high-quality products that meet customer expectations, thereby significantly contributing to value creation.
  • Florists - SIC 5992
    Importance: Important
    Description: Florists provide fresh flowers and decorative elements that enhance the aesthetic appeal of gift baskets. These inputs are important as they add a personal touch to the baskets, making them more attractive and suitable for special occasions.
  • Durable Goods, Not Elsewhere Classified - SIC 5099
    Importance: Supplementary
    Description: This industry supplies various packaging materials such as boxes, ribbons, and decorative paper that are crucial for assembling gift baskets. The relationship is supplementary as these inputs enhance the presentation and protection of the products, contributing to the overall customer experience.

Downstream Industries

  • Direct to Consumer- SIC
    Importance: Critical
    Description: Outputs from the Gift Baskets & Parcels (Retail) industry are primarily sold directly to consumers who seek personalized gifts for various occasions such as birthdays, holidays, and corporate events. The quality and creativity of these products are paramount for ensuring customer satisfaction and repeat business.
  • Corporate Clients- SIC
    Importance: Important
    Description: Corporate clients often purchase gift baskets for employee recognition, client appreciation, and promotional events. The relationship is important as these baskets serve as a means to strengthen business relationships and enhance brand image through thoughtful gifting.
  • Institutional Market- SIC
    Importance: Supplementary
    Description: Some gift baskets are sold to institutions such as hospitals and schools for fundraising events or as thank-you gifts. This relationship supplements the industry’s revenue streams and allows for broader market reach.

Primary Activities

Inbound Logistics: Receiving and handling processes involve inspecting and sorting incoming supplies such as food items, flowers, and packaging materials to ensure they meet quality standards. Storage practices include maintaining appropriate conditions for perishables and organizing inventory for easy access. Quality control measures are implemented to verify the freshness and quality of inputs, addressing challenges such as spoilage through effective inventory rotation and supplier management.

Operations: Core processes in this industry include designing and assembling gift baskets based on customer specifications, which involves selecting appropriate items, arranging them attractively, and packaging them securely. Quality management practices involve regular checks to ensure that the baskets meet aesthetic and quality standards, with operational considerations focusing on efficiency in assembly and customer customization requests.

Outbound Logistics: Distribution systems typically involve direct shipping to customers or delivery through local services. Quality preservation during delivery is achieved through careful packaging to prevent damage and maintain the integrity of perishable items. Common practices include using tracking systems to monitor shipments and ensure timely delivery, enhancing customer satisfaction.

Marketing & Sales: Marketing approaches in this industry often focus on seasonal promotions and themed baskets that cater to specific occasions. Customer relationship practices involve personalized service and follow-up communications to enhance customer loyalty. Value communication methods emphasize the uniqueness and quality of the gift baskets, while typical sales processes include online orders, phone orders, and in-store purchases, often supported by engaging visual displays.

Service: Post-sale support practices include providing customers with information on care instructions for perishable items and options for customization. Customer service standards are high, ensuring prompt responses to inquiries and issues. Value maintenance activities involve soliciting feedback to improve product offerings and enhance customer satisfaction.

In-Depth Marketing Analysis

A detailed overview of the Gift Baskets & Parcels (Retail) industry’s market dynamics, competitive landscape, and operational conditions, highlighting the unique factors influencing its day-to-day activities.

Market Overview

Market Size: Medium

Description: This industry specializes in the creation and retail of gift baskets and parcels tailored for various occasions, featuring a diverse selection of items such as gourmet foods, beverages, and small gifts. The operational boundaries include both pre-made and customized offerings, catering to individual consumer preferences.

Market Stage: Growth. The industry is currently in a growth stage, driven by increasing consumer interest in personalized gifting options and the convenience of ready-made gift solutions.

Geographic Distribution: Regional. Operations are often regionally concentrated, with retailers located in urban areas where consumer demand for gift items is higher, while also serving surrounding suburban communities.

Characteristics

  • Customization Options: Daily operations often involve creating personalized gift baskets based on customer specifications, which can include selecting specific items, themes, and packaging styles to suit various occasions.
  • Seasonal Promotions: Retailers frequently engage in seasonal promotions, aligning their offerings with holidays and special events, which significantly influences inventory management and marketing strategies.
  • Online Sales Channels: A substantial portion of sales occurs through online platforms, allowing retailers to reach a broader audience and streamline the ordering process for customers.
  • Local Sourcing: Many retailers prioritize local sourcing of products to enhance the uniqueness of their gift baskets, supporting local businesses while appealing to consumers' preferences for locally made goods.
  • Gift-Wrapping Services: In addition to selling gift baskets, many retailers offer gift-wrapping services, adding value to their products and enhancing the overall customer experience.

Market Structure

Market Concentration: Fragmented. The market is fragmented, characterized by a mix of small independent shops and larger retail chains, allowing for a wide variety of product offerings and price points.

Segments

  • Corporate Gifting: This segment focuses on providing customized gift baskets for businesses, catering to corporate events, client appreciation, and employee recognition, often involving bulk orders.
  • Special Occasion Gifts: Retailers serve customers looking for gifts for specific occasions such as birthdays, anniversaries, and holidays, emphasizing personalization and thematic presentation.
  • Holiday Gifts: This segment capitalizes on seasonal demand, offering themed gift baskets for holidays like Christmas, Valentine's Day, and Easter, which significantly boosts sales during peak seasons.

Distribution Channels

  • Retail Stores: Physical retail locations play a crucial role in allowing customers to browse and select gift baskets in person, enhancing the shopping experience through visual merchandising.
  • E-commerce Platforms: Online sales channels are increasingly important, enabling retailers to reach a wider audience and provide convenient shopping options, often complemented by delivery services.

Success Factors

  • Quality of Products: Offering high-quality items within gift baskets is essential for customer satisfaction and repeat business, as consumers expect value for their purchases.
  • Effective Marketing Strategies: Successful retailers utilize targeted marketing campaigns to reach specific demographics, particularly during peak gifting seasons, to drive sales.
  • Strong Customer Service: Providing excellent customer service, including responsive communication and handling of special requests, is vital for building customer loyalty and positive word-of-mouth.
